Sweetwater Creek State Park is a peaceful tract of wilderness only minutes from downtown Atlanta. Park rangers lead informative hikes to park areas throughout the year. The 215-acre George Sparks Reservoir is popular with anglers and provides a pretty setting for feeding ducks and picnicking. During warmer months, the park rents fishing boats, canoes and pedal boats. The Visitor Center features exhibits on the area’s history, wildlife displays, trail maps, snacks and a gift shop.
